## Step 4: Update your cache settings

With the Lattermere tile-rendering cache now split into hot and cold tiers, plugins that previously wrote directly to the unified store must declare a tier preference. The cold tier accepts larger tiles but enforces stricter eviction, so audit your tile sizes before migrating. Plugins that skip this step will fall back to hot-tier defaults, which may evict aggressively. Point your plugin at the new tier using these configuration values:

config for yajep-tafof:
[rusath]
team = julmir
access_code = ac_fe37fd
host = rusath.novactech.test
port = 8000
owner = pelmir.weneth
peer = oliwyn.olvarqdyn.internal

## v2.4.1 — 2024-11-08

Branchsweep now ignores branches with open merge requests in Gittavern, fixing accidental deletion warnings reported by the Quillfork team. Stale threshold raised from 60 to 90 days. Dry-run mode is the new default for first-time repos. Rollback instructions are in the release notes. Direct any deployment concerns to the maintainer listed below.

approver of yajef-fajef = Oliwyn Silion Kasok Kasox

Ticket: AddrPilot autocomplete vault locked after failed deploy

The secrets vault backing the AddrPilot address autocomplete widget sealed itself after three failed unseal attempts during last night's deploy. Until it is reopened, suggestion requests fall back to the stale regional cache, which is missing the Norvale postal updates. Please unseal carefully: verify the node is the primary replica first, then run the standard unseal flow. The recovery passphrase for the vault is below.

recovery phrase for bagef-badup: drueth-jorix-fenir-caseth-tamax-druix-praok-jormir-aldiel-sordor-jordor-aldax-pramir

## Welcome to the Inkfold team!

Inkfold is our PDF invoice renderer — it turns billing events from Ledgerbird into the pretty invoices customers actually see. To run it locally, clone the repo, install the font bundle, and copy the sample env file. Rendering works offline, but fetching real invoice data needs access to the Ledgerbird sandbox. Drop the sandbox API secret on the line right after this one.

sealed setting: VAULT_KEY20=c8ea1e419912889df6b4